How delightful to be introduced to a gem of a place, so close to home. Ayr is an easy thirty minute drive from Kitchener. Willibald features a flavourful selection of beers, cocktails, wines, seltzer, vodka, and gin. Although the establishment is called a "Distillery and Brewery", the kitchen serves up gourmet-level food. The, "Willi Burger", rivaled the best burgers I've had, and I've had a few. The fries too were a cut above, a fresh cut above at that. The rest of the experienced diners in our party had very good things to say about the, fresh and locally-sourced Grilled Zucchini, Caesar salad, Roasted Red Pepper and Cheese Dip, and the "Korean BBQ" Chicken Sandwich. This countryside oasis is worth the drive.

Stopped in for lunch and was very impressed. Have loved their beer and gin for some time now, but had never come out for food. Funghi pizza was delicious. The crust was light, airy, crispy, and flaky at the same time and held its shape crust to tip, retaining the same crispiness throughout. Toppings were excellent. The use of pickled red onions and arugula chimichurri made the pizza just that much better. The creamy garlic dipping sauce was wholly unnecessary (the pizza and crust stand on their own), but was very well made and delicious. I found it overpowered the funghi pizza, so enjoyed it just with pieces of the crust. Beer, as always was exceptional, as was their signature gin mule using their barrel aged gin and homemade ginger tea - the perfect balance of ginger spiciness with modest sweetness. Atmosphere was also excellent on the patio. Service was great (thanks Brooke and co.)! 10/10, will return.

My wife and I have been planning to have supper here for some time now. Unfortunately the restaurant (Biergarten) is only open weekends and tends to be busy, so that presented a challenge for us. However, this evening we managed to go. As expected, the place was busy when we arrived at 5:30 pm and there was a 30-40 minute wait. Fortunately, the bar is open and you can buy canned & bottled drinks to go and enjoy at picnic tables in a nearby pasture while you wait. Since it was a cool and pleasant evening, this merely added to the sense of relaxation and enjoyment of the whole dining experience. Once seated under the tent for our meal, we just had to start out by trying the Dill Pickle French Fries. These turned out to be by far the best fries we've ever eaten! Not only were they perfectly done (a rare occurrence anywhere in the restaurant world!) but they were nicely salted, flavoured with dill pickle seasoning, and accompanied by a delicious garlic & dill sauce. Our only complaint here was that there wasn't nearly enough sauce for all those fries. Would like to see at least twice as much sauce accompanying this order! For mains, my wife had the Willy Burger with double smash patties. Our standard for burgers is Sam's Grill and my wife said that this burger matched Sam's but just didn't have all the extra condiments on it. I had the Randy Special pizza because it was different in terms of toppings from a normal pizza and especially enjoyed the white sauce, pepperoni, and basil pesto on it! It's only a 9-inch pizza, but was filling enough for me. All in all, a great dining experience. Also took advantage of being there to grab a bottle of their Original Aged Gin. I don't know if it's the fact that it's aged in oak casks or not, but this has got to be the smoothest gin I've ever had! Highly recommended!
